The Med Spa curse-3 ways they limit growth

How med spas self-sabotage and limit their growth

You may own a med spa. Or you work at one. Or have been to one recently.

Every single med spa owner I've talked to has been sophisticated, well educated, and wanted to portray a luxury experience. But few actually do. And they can't figure out why.

Here are three ways med spas self-sabotage and limit their growth.

  1. They target the wrong patients.


    The thought process is if we post an ad for Botox, we'll sell them on filler. Or if we have a $99 deal, we'll make them lifetime clients.

    This isn't true because $99 patients don't magically become $999 patients. Target the filler patients, even if you get less of them, because the profit margins will be higher, and they'll be your ideal patients- they'll also refer others for similar procedures.


  2. They focus on their services instead of the patient experience.


    Every med spa can do Botox and filler. Every single one offers water. Every single one has chairs for patients to sit and read magazines while they wait. These are not special or extraordinary. But consider having a waiting room for VIP patients, where they have their favorite magazines there, or wine, or a masseuse? Yes, a real masseuse to massage them until it's their turn. Don't you think this kind of experience would not only make them loyal patients, but they'd rant and rave about the experience to all their friends, giving them instant FOMO?

    You can call them before their appointment and ask if they'd like a cold brew or a hot matcha ready as they arrive. Or have freshly bakes cookies. The list is endless.


  3. Their content doesn't show real experiences.


    So what are they showing on their Instagram and Tik Toks? Often times, it's following trends. Or it's highly produced commercials and then they're stagnant for 6 months. These can get likes and a few "oh nice!" comments. But they don't "Ooooh and Ahhhh" people to the point they're sending the photo or reel to their closest 3 friends. Show transformations, before and afters, but also the reaction from the patients. Have them send videos of getting ready to go out on a hot Tinder date, or they're making their ex jealous, or they're getting glammed up for a wedding, whatever it is, there's a reason and story there. Show it. No one really cares about the newest machine you spent $150,000 for which has already depreciated to $8750.
